Transaction 6204fac25368c3f5477dd982bdf250a15c20ffdbc02e5627ecf735b804bcc103
1 Input
1 Output
-
6204fac25368c3f5477dd982bdf250a15c20ffdbc02e5627ecf735b804bcc103:0
- value
- 10110658
- script pubkey
- OP_0 OP_PUSHBYTES_20 db89bc4e95cdadde6a26c7cb1b7e01ad28043881
- address
- bc1qmwymcn54ekkau63xcl93klsp455qgwypfskf6c